Flagstone grout repair services focus on restoring the integrity and appearance of the grout lines between flagstone surfaces. Over time, grout can become cracked, crumbled, or stained due to exposure to weather, foot traffic, or natural settling. Repairing or replacing damaged grout helps prevent water from seeping behind the stones, which can lead to further damage like shifting or loosening of the flagstones.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ques and materials to carefully remove deteriorated grout and apply fresh, durable joint material that matches the existing pattern and color.
This type of repair addresses common problems such as cracked or missing grout, which can compromise the stability of the entire flagstone installation. When grout deteriorates, it often allows moisture to penetrate beneath the stones, increasing the risk of erosion, weed growth, or even frost damage in colder climates. Repairing grout can also improve the overall appearance of a flagstone surface, making it look cleaner and more uniform. Whether the issue is minor cracking or significant deterioration, professional contractors can assess the condition of the grout and recommend the appropriate repair or replacement approach.

What causes flagstone grout to need repair? Common causes include shifting of the flagstone, water damage, and the use of improper grout materials, which can lead to cracking or deterioration over time.
How can I tell if my flagstone grout need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, gaps, discoloration, or loose sections that indicate the grout is compromised and may require attention from local contractors.
What types of grout repair services are available for flagstone? Services typically involve re-grouting, filling cracks, and sealing to restore the integrity and appearance of the flagstone surface.
Are there different options for repairing flagstone grout? Yes, local service providers may offer various repair methods, including traditional grout replacement or specialized sealants, depending on the condition of the existing grout.
